TN HB 2473
died on adjournmentHealth Care - As introduced, deletes an obsolete section regarding the creation of a task force to study methods on how to best prevent cardiovascular disease, hypertension, and diabetes in this state. - Amends TCA Title 53 and Title 68.

Did TN HB 2473 pass?
No. TN HB 2473 died when the 114S1 session adjourned without final action on it. Bills that die this way are sometimes reintroduced in a later session. Latest recorded action (2026-03-31): Sponsor(s) Added.
What is TN HB 2473 about?
TN HB 2473 is a bill in the 114S1 titled “Health Care - As introduced, deletes an obsolete section regarding the creation of a task force to study methods on how to best prevent cardiovascular disease, hypertension, and diabetes in this state. - Amends TCA Title 53 and Title 68.”.
Who sponsors TN HB 2473?
Faison is the primary sponsor of TN HB 2473.
